Description

This za'atar spice recipe is easy to make at home from scratch with just four ingredients. While in Lebanon wild thyme is used, regular thyme from the supermarket or your garden makes a fine substitute. Za'atar refers both to the thyme plant itself, as well as this spice mix.

Ingredients
  • 3 tablespoons sesame seeds
  • 3 tablespoons fresh thyme leaves
  • 1 tablespoon sumac pow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
Directions
  1. 1. Toast sesame seeds in a dry skillet over medium heat until just golden, about 3 to 5 minutes.
  2. 2. Combine sesame seeds, thyme leaves, sumac, and salt in a bowl and stir until well combined.
